Where to Use with Caution
While the Eye of the Anubis is incredibly versatile, there are a few considerations when using it on specific materials or products:
- Small lettering: If the design includes text, ensure it's large enough to remain legible after stitching.
- Delicate details: The intricate parts of the eye may require careful handling during the embroidery process to avoid distortion.
- Textured fabric: While the design can work on various textures, extra stabilizer may be needed to maintain clarity.
- Thick towels: Thicker materials might require adjusting stitch density or using a different hoop size.
- Stretchy baby clothes: For stretchy fabrics, consider using a stabilizer to prevent puckering.
- Curved surfaces: The design should be tested on curved items like mugs or bottles to ensure proper alignment.
- Dark fabric: Always check thread color contrast before finalizing your design to ensure visibility.
- Frequent washing: If the finished product will be washed often, confirm that the design holds up over time.

Practical Embroidery Notes
To ensure the best results when working with the Eye of the Anubis design, follow these practical steps:
- Test on scrap fabric: Always do a test run to see how the design looks and feels on the intended material.
- Check thread color contrast: Ensure that the colors chosen stand out against the fabric background.
- Confirm hoop size: Check the recommended hoop size based on the design dimensions to avoid stretching or misalignment.
- Review stitch density: Adjust stitch density if necessary to match the fabric type and desired finish.
- Use proper stabilizer: Especially important for stretchy or textured fabrics to keep the design crisp and clean.
- Compare light and dark fabric mockups: See how the design appears on different backgrounds before finalizing your product.
- Check small details after stitching: Look closely for any imperfections or inconsistencies that may have occurred during the embroidery process.
- Confirm commercial licensing: Make sure you have the appropriate rights to sell any finished products featuring this design.
